blob: 76e9c8a41f4dbbb3012e6da52e6793b89f26986a [file] [log] [blame]
Jagpal Singh Gille6fc3b72024-11-20 18:09:28 -08001{
2 "$schema": "http://json-schema.org/draft-07/schema#",
3 "$defs": {
4 "FirmwareInfoDef": {
5 "description": "This indicates the properties which apply to all firmwares",
6 "type": "object",
7 "properties": {
8 "VendorIANA": {
9 "description": "The IANA Enterprise Id of the hardware vendor",
10 "type": "number"
11 },
12 "CompatibleHardware": {
13 "description": "The compatible hardware with name format com.<vendor>.Hardware.<XXX> specified by vendor in phosphor-dbus-interfaces",
14 "type": "string"
15 }
16 },
Jagpal Singh Gill34f4d152025-02-18 22:58:24 -080017 "required": ["VendorIANA", "CompatibleHardware"]
Jagpal Singh Gille6fc3b72024-11-20 18:09:28 -080018 }
19 }
20}